How many diamonds does it take to say ‘I love you’? Nine, on this occasion, snug within a daisy clusterA group of small diamonds or colourful gemstones grouped together to form a cluster, mimicking the look of a larger gem. Often this group can surround a larger center stone.. Perhaps to celebrate a ten year anniversary? Or simply as an impressive engagement ring? This early 19th century example, circa 1900-1910, of a classic style is set with good sized, bright and well matched old mine cutAn 18th, 19th and early 20th century diamond shape, typically cushion or asymmetrical, marked by a small table, a high crown and a large culet. Culets are the small flat facets at the bottom of a stone which appear to the untrained eye as a hole in the middle of the stone. Before the advent of modern machinery which allows for the precise faceting we see tod… diamonds, which, due to their high crowns, throw out an abundance of fire and sparkle and the platinumDerives from the Spanish word ‘platina’ meaning ‘little silver’. Acknowledged since the 1900s, platinum’s durability and natural brightness has been and still is today highly treasured A metallic element prized for its rarity, whiteness, high tensile strength and insusceptibility to corrosion, platinum first became widely used in jewellery in the late ninete… tipped claws enhance the white of the stones. It is a beautiful ring that was made in France.
